Technical history of miscellaneous underwater weapons.
Includes 31 photographs depicting: Admiralty Underwater Weapons Establishment: depth charges; countermining pistols; rope cutting device; igniters; iniator (watertight): firing mechanisms; casings; magnetic mines (Tench and Perch); underwater mines (UWS); skimming projectile (prototype). Dated [1949].
